Making jelly

I am making apple juice from my grandaddy's apple straight from his orchard! The juice I am making will be used to flavor the jelly I will be making tomorrow in my canning class.

Here is how my juice is looking so far. I took the apples and simmered them in a little bit of water -1 cup of water for every heaping quart. Then you pour the apples and water through cheese cloth. I took the cheese cloth and pulled it up around the apples.

There is the bag hanging from the cabinet. After this drips or at least until bed time I have to bring it to 190 degrees to pasteurize it with heat. This will kill any E coli O157 H:7. I will let you know how the jelly turns out!
